Web26 okt. 2024 · So, how fast do NHL players shoot? The average NHL player can shoot the puck at around 80mph. However, some players can shoot much harder than that. The record for the hardest shot in an NHL game is held by Zdeno Chara who recorded a 108.8mph shot! So, there you have it. Web1-3-1 Formation. The 1-3-1 is a newer strategy that has been implemented by teams in the offensive zone. Similar to the 1-2-2, the 1-3-1 includes one primary forechecker pressuring the opposing team in the offensive zone. Two players will be providing support on each half-wall, usually one forward and one defenseman.
